WebJul 17, 2024 · The FITT principle stands for frequency, intensity, time and type of exercise. These are four components that we can consider when creating a training programme. The four components are interconnected and how we manipulate them within a training programme, will influence the outcome of that programme. WebThe Overload Principle Written by Bryce Smith The overload principle basically states that an exercise must become more challenging over the course of a training program in order to continue to produce results. In the context of strength training, this is done by adding weight to the bar. An example of a program that uses the overload principle would be one that …

WebFITT and the Principle of Overload Assignment In order to be effective, a medical prescription has to be exact. It must include the name of the medicine, the dose needed, and how often the medicine should be taken. The same information needs to be present in an Exercise Prescription. WebOct 24, 2016 · The principle of progression asserts that you should progress overload, which can be performed by applying FITT (frequency, intensity, time, and type) when your body accommodates to its present routine. The specificity principle asserts that only targeted activities will promote specific health goals.
